San Diego County, CA November 7, 2006 Election
Smart Voter Full Biography for Steven A. "Steve" (Tauvela) Yagyagan

Candidate for
Board Member; Chula Vista Elementary School District; Seat 5

Steve was born and reared in Waialua, Hawaii. His father, Pio Ibanez Yagyagan, was a Sakada who fought side-by-side with American troops during WWII and came to Hawaii in 1946 to work in the sugarcane fields. His mother, Miliama Tauvela, was a pineapple packer and a nurse's aide. Miliama's dad, Sgt./Rev. Mulifanua Tauvela, was a windtalker for the U.s. Army during WWII. Steve and his siblings were encouraged by Pio and Miliama to do well in school and honor their community and country through patriotism and civic duty. His parents read books and told stories to the children from infancy through elementary school.

After completing his Associates degree in Liberal Arts through the University of Hawaii, Steve left the islands in 1983 to complete his Bachelors degree in Broadcast Communications from San Francisco State University. During Steve's early years, he worked as a broadcaster in Honolulu and San Francisco and also worked in sales and operations at FedEx for nearly nine years in San Francisco and San Diego. He later achieved his Masters degree in Organizational Management from The University of Phoenix. Steve has now set his sight on achieving his doctoral degree in Organizational Leadership. He wants to continue to work on getting people in the workplace and the community to work together effectively to achieve their organizational goals.

Steve has been active in much of the Asian Pacific Islander community in San Diego, San Francisco and Honolulu. He has also been active in supporting fundraisers for literacy, awareness and cures for breast cancer , arthritis, cystic fibrosis and many other civic interests.

Steve is concerned about the continued decline in management of the Chula Vista Elementary School Disrict. The current administration has become a closed society that has done nothing to encourage input and resolution to concerns from the parents, the teachers and the students. As a result, the CVESD has become polarized. He believes the CVESD needs an overhaul to establish a solid foundation for academic excellence in order to prepare our children for middle school, high school, college and viable leaders for our community's and our country's future. Steve's commitment is to put children first in all CVESD decision-making. To achieve this goal, he believes we need strong leaders at the top who will recruit and support exceptionally talented educators for our elementary schools.

Steve married his college sweetheart, Regina Jularbal Madayag Bangalan, in 1988. Together, Steve and Regina have two children, Matthew (16) and Gabrielle (8).
